Mohawk Place closing at the end of January

Final show planned for Jan. 31

By Elmer Ploetz

It was just one line in the weekly Mohawk Place email Thursday night (Jan. 9): “Mohawk Place will indeed be closing at the end of the month.”

New to the schedule is the farewell show on Friday, Jan. 31, featuring Handsome Jack, The Irving Klaws, Evil Things, Malarchuk, Nine Layers Deep, Cooler and “others.” The show has a 4 p.m. door time, with performances starting at 5 p.m. and likely lasting late into the night and, who knows, maybe the morning,

Other shows that are scheduled for this month are still on the schedule, including:

  • The GOA and Hold Out recording release show with Do Crime, On the Cinder and Bile Study on Friday, Jan. 10.
  • The Damages, The Queen Guillotined and Mental Anguish show on Friday, Jan. 17.
  • The Mat Kerekes, Equipment and Bike Routes show on Saturday, Jan. 18.
  • Winter Reigns V, with the Last Reign, Winter Nights, Kill Uncle and Morgue Terror on Saturday, Jan. 25.

Two February shows have already been moved:

  • Brooke Surgener & Star Theory, Nancy Dunkle and Akloh on Feb. 8 has been moved to the Rec Room.
  • Sarah & the Safe Word with Everybody’s Worried About Owen, Machinery of the Human Heart and All Maine Points has been moved to the Evening Star Concert Hall in Niagara Falls.

A third show, with Fooled By Eve, Seneca Peak and Dead Orchids, is in the process of being moved.
